Output 8cba80a6a598ca6e3efc0e41343aa804bafcfca8022f8e171f270121d822e33a:3

value
163343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98f7f95db59c17814c131b2f2aa7c90dde0ac22a OP_EQUAL
address
3FdqhF5WdWXdo143Qvczk22gbLD4yaoNv7
transaction
8cba80a6a598ca6e3efc0e41343aa804bafcfca8022f8e171f270121d822e33a
spent
true